Sports Minister speaks on Osimhen outburst
Sports Minister John Owan Enoh has spoken for the first time on the outburst by Napoli striker Victor Osimhen in which he disrespected coach Finidi George.
The Sports Minister told Eagle7 FM Radio that he ordered the NFF not to make a pronouncement on the matter until they have heard from Osimhen.
“There has been a plethora of opinions on this,” he said.
“Osimhen is a Trojan for Nigeria, but it was a low.
“I told the NFF not to make a pronouncement on this before they have engaged Osimhen.
“This is so especially because these are not the best of times for Nigeria football and we have to manage a lot of things.
“The NFF have to be focused and not be distracted.”
